.car-number-license-box{
    width: 6.8rem;
    border-radius: 0.1rem;
    margin: 0 auto;
    overflow: hidden;
    background-color: #3385ff;
}

.car-number-license-box .car-number-license-title{
    height: 1.2rem;
    text-align: left;
    line-height: 0.6rem;
    font-size: 0.4rem;
    padding-left: 0.3rem;
    font-weight: 700;
    color: #ffffff;
    padding-top: 0.2rem;
}

.car-number-license-box .car-number-license-title .description {
    font-size: 0.28rem;
    font-weight: normal;
}
.car-number-license-box .car-number-license-content-box {
    margin-top: 0.2rem;
    padding-top: 0.8rem;
    padding-bottom: 0.2rem;
    background: #ffffff;
    border-top-left-radius: 6.8rem 2rem;
    border-top-right-radius: 6.8rem 2rem;
}
.car-number-license-box .car-number-license-main{
    width: 100%;
    height: 1rem;
    display: flex;
    flex-direction: column;
    align-items: center;
    justify-content: center;
    font-weight: 700;
    font-size: 0.4rem;
}

.car-number-license-box .no-plate-car-number-license-main{
    height: auto !important;
}

.car-number-license-box .car-number-license-main .description {
    display: block;
    width: 6.3rem;
    margin: 0 auto;
    font-weight: normal;
    text-align: left;

}

.car-number-license-box .car-number-license-main ul{
    width: 6.3rem;
    height: 1rem;
    display: flex;
    flex-direction: row;
    align-items: center;
    justify-content: center;
    border: 0.02rem solid #8799a3;
    border-radius: 0.1rem;
}
.car-number-license-box .car-number-license-main ul li{
    width: 0.78rem;
    height: 0.7rem;
    text-align: center;
    line-height: 0.7rem;
    float: left;
    color: #00154C;
}
/*.car-number-license-box .car-number-license-main ul li:last-of-type{*/
/*    margin: 0;*/
/*    display: none;*/
/*}*/

.car-number-license-box .car-number-license-main ul li:nth-child(2) {
    border-right: 0.02rem solid #8799a3;
}

.car-number-license-box .car-number-license-main ul li.active{
    /*border: 0.01rem solid greenyellow;*/
    /*border-radius: 0.05rem;*/
}
.car-number-license-box .car-number-license-main ul li.new-energy{
    /*background: url(../images/new-energy.png) no-repeat center;*/
    /*background-size: 100% 100%;*/
}

.car-number-license-box .car-number-license-history {
    width: 6.3rem;
    font-weight: 700;
    font-size: 0.4rem;
    margin: 0 auto;
    overflow: hidden;
}

.car-number-license-box .car-number-license-history ul {
    width: 6.3rem;
    display: block;
    border-radius: 0.1rem;
    font-size: 0.28rem;
    font-weight: normal;
    color: #bfbfbf;
    border-top: 0.01rem solid #bfbfbf;
}

.car-number-license-box .car-number-license-history ul li {
    display: block;
    width: 5.8rem;
    height: 0.6rem;
    line-height: 0.6rem;
    font-size: 0.28rem;
    font-weight: normal;
    color: #bfbfbf;
    background: url(../images/history.png) no-repeat left;
    background-size: 0.45rem 0.4rem;
    padding-left: 0.5rem;
}

.car-number-license-box .car-number-license-history ul li .car-number {
    display: block;
    width: 5.3rem;
    height: 0.6rem;
    line-height: 0.6rem;
    float: left;
}

.car-number-license-box .car-number-license-history ul li .delete-car-number {
    display: block;
    float: left;
    width: 0.5rem;
    height: 0.5rem;
    line-height: 0.5rem;
    margin-top: 0.05rem;
    background: url(../images/close_3x.png) no-repeat center;
    background-size: 0.2rem 0.2rem;
    outline: none;
    border-style: none;
}

.keyboard-box {
    width: 100%;
    position: fixed;
    bottom: 0;
    left: 0;
    z-index: 999;
    display: none;
}

.keyboard-box .keyboard-operation {
    width: 100%;
    height: 40px;
    line-height: 20px;
    background: #f4f4f6;
}

.keyboard-box .keyboard-operation button {
    height: 40px;
    line-height: 40px;
    float: right;
    color: dodgerblue;
    padding-right: 10px;
    outline: none;
    background: none;
    border-style: none;
}

.keyboard-box .province-box, .keyboard-box .text-box {
    width: 100%;
    background-color: #D0D5D9;
    padding-top: 10px;
    padding-bottom: 4px;
}

.keyboard-box .province-box ul, .keyboard-box .text-box ul{
    width: 100%;
    display: flex;
    flex-direction: row;
    justify-content: space-around;
    align-items: center;
    margin-top: 10px;
}

.keyboard-box .province-box ul:first-of-type, .keyboard-box .text-box ul:first-of-type{
    margin-top: 0px;
}

.keyboard-box .province-box ul li, .keyboard-box .text-box ul li{
    width: 30px;
    height: 43px;
    border-radius: 6px;
    text-align: center;
    line-height: 43px;
    float: left;
    background-color: #ffffff;
}

.keyboard-box .text-box {
    display: none;
}

.keyboard-box .province-box ul .change-btn, .keyboard-box .province-box ul .delete-btn, .keyboard-box .text-box ul .change-btn, .keyboard-box .text-box ul .delete-btn{
    width: 40px;
    height: 40px;
    background-color: #ACB3BB;
    text-align: center;
    line-height: 40px;
}

.text-box ul li:click{
    background: #0088CC;
}

.province-box ul li:click{
    background: #0088CC;
}


@keyframes scaleDraw {  /*定义关键帧、scaleDrew是需要绑定到选择器的关键帧名称*/
    0%{
        transform: scale(1);  /*开始为原始大小*/
    }
    25%{
        transform: scale(1.3); /*放大1.1倍*/
    }
    50%{
        transform: scale(1.3);
    }
    100%{
        transform: scale(1);
    }
}

.active-key{
    background-color: #ACB3BB !important;
    /*background: #999 !important;*/
    opacity: 0.8;
    color: #fff;
    -webkit-animation-name: scaleDraw; /*关键帧名称*/
    -webkit-animation-timing-function: ease-in-out; /*动画的速度曲线*/
    -webkit-animation-duration: 0.2s; /*动画所花费的时间*/
}

.fapiao-box {
    display: flex;
    flex-direction: column;
    width: 6.4rem;
    margin: 0 auto;
    padding-bottom: 0.4rem;
}

.fapiao-box .fapiao-item {
    display: flex;
    flex-direction: row;
    height: 0.8rem;
    align-items: center;
}
.fapiao-box .fapiao-item .label {
    width: 2rem;
}
.fapiao-box .fapiao-item input {
    flex: 1;
    outline: none;
    border: none;
    height: 0.6rem;
    line-height: 0.6rem;
    border-bottom: 1px solid #bfbfbf;
    color: #bfbfbf;
}
.fapiao-box .fapiao-item .label span {
    color: red;
}
